Browse Source

Forgot to commit 2 files

git-svn-id: svn://svn.sharpdevelop.net/sharpdevelop/trunk@3178 1ccf3a8d-04fe-1044-b7c0-cef0b8235c61
shortcuts
David Srbecký 17 years ago
parent
commit
d17efd1045
  1. 8
      src/AddIns/Misc/Debugger/Debugger.Core/Project/Src/Control/NDebugger-Breakpoints.cs
  2. 6
      src/AddIns/Misc/Debugger/Debugger.Core/Project/Src/Debugger/Breakpoint.cs

8
src/AddIns/Misc/Debugger/Debugger.Core/Project/Src/Control/NDebugger-Breakpoints.cs

@ -83,9 +83,11 @@ namespace Debugger @@ -83,9 +83,11 @@ namespace Debugger
public void RemoveBreakpoint(Breakpoint breakpoint)
{
breakpoint.Deactivate();
breakpointCollection.Remove(breakpoint);
OnBreakpointRemoved(breakpoint);
if (breakpointCollection.Contains(breakpoint)) {
breakpoint.Deactivate();
breakpointCollection.Remove(breakpoint);
OnBreakpointRemoved(breakpoint);
}
}
void MarkBreakpointsAsDeactivated()

6
src/AddIns/Misc/Debugger/Debugger.Core/Project/Src/Debugger/Breakpoint.cs

@ -137,6 +137,12 @@ namespace Debugger @@ -137,6 +137,12 @@ namespace Debugger
return true;
}
/// <summary> Remove this breakpoint </summary>
public void Remove()
{
debugger.RemoveBreakpoint(this);
}
}
[Serializable]

Loading…
Cancel
Save